Creating wrong redirects containing characters/queries that shouldn't be uploaded the upload/download of the csv through the CLI doesn't work
ID: 971936
No Fix
Published on 1/25/2024
Last update on 1/25/2024

Summary

After creating wrong redirects containing characters that should not be uploaded: ie.: #, queries, or redirects that should be created on the server level, the mass upload/download of the csv through the CLI doesn't work anymore.

Simulation

Create a redirect for a query for example: /?binding=XXXXX Delete the redirect by the graphql IDE (you won't be able to delete otherwise) Try to download or upload the CSV of the redirects through the CLI and you want be able to do it.

Workaround

There is currently no workaround for this and the CLI mass download will be unusable.
